Multi-Material Engraving Jig for Bambu H2D Laser

Unlock the full potential of your Bambu H2D laser with this purpose-built Multi-Material Engraving Jig, designed for precision, repeatability, and versatility.
 

Whether you're working with official Bambu materials or third-party alternatives, this jig holds them securely in place, ensuring perfect alignment every time. Engineered with care and thoroughly tested, it accommodates a wide variety of popular blanks, including:

  • Bambu 20mm Round Steel Tags
  • Bambu 30mm Round Steel Tags
  • Bambu & Temu Aluminum Cards (54x86mm)
  • Bambu PU Leather Patches (51x76mm)
  • Steel Plates from Temu (30x50mm)
  • Rounded Steel Tags with Hole (18x50mm)

Whether you're engraving for personal projects, small-batch production, or custom gifts, this jig makes your workflow faster and more consistent — with no guesswork or misalignment.
 

Perfect fit onto the Bambu jagged horizontal guide rails. This will prevent the jig from slipping as the H2D is engraving. 

 

Print-ready and easy to use, it's a must-have accessory for anyone serious about maximizing their Bambu H2D laser engraving setup.

When setting the height in the Bambu Suite, it is recommended to use the Targeted-Measure to ensure measuring the correct thickness of your material to engrave on.
